    Enjoyable stay but needs improvement

    My first time staying at a Travelodge in Edinburgh and was pleasantly surprised despite a few areas that needed improvement. The hotel itself is well-furnished and clean, I was informed by the staff at the desk that it had recently undergone refurbishment which I must say they did a great job (at least in the common areas). I had booked an accessible room which was very spacious however it did feel quite dreary and depressing due to the fact it was on the lower ground floor and the windows were quite dirty and do not open. Along side this, the radiator was left on when I entered the room which I swiftly turned off as the room was boiling (and also very sunny and warm outside too!) The beds were two singles as I was travelling with my parent. They were okay but could definitely be improved. The mattress felt as though it was drooping to one side and the pillows were lumpy. But considering it was somewhere to lay our heads for the night, it was acceptable. In the room was a small TV on the wall, which in an accessible room it would be nice if there was a way to adjust the height of this? Maybe place it on an adjustable stand or bracket? There was also no TV remote provided for it. The accessible bathroom was lovely. No complaints there. Very happy with it! The room overall was good for the price and fit our needs. Sadly due to the uncomfortable beds I wouldn't stay again but perhaps I would try one of the other Travelodge's in town that has the new Super rooms.

    UPDATE Disappointing NO Accessible room available and moved to another hotel

    This is my third review for the hotel. It has now become my go to place to stay when I am in Edinburgh. On my recent visit to Scotland I had stayed in this Travelodge on 14 - 16 April 2024, then had 3 nights on a coach tour, and was booked to stay in an accessible room on 18 April 2024, for one night when I arrived back from my coach tour. I had told the staff on duty during my stay that I would be returning on the Friday night. I was therefore shocked to arrive on the Friday at about 6.40pm to be informed that they had no accessible room for me as the building was being refurbished. Please see comments about staff below to see how this was handled. But the quick answer was I had to stay at another hotel.
